One of Yorkshire's prettiest coastal locations, Runswick Bay is characterised by charming red-roofed cottages that cling to the hillside above a sweeping, sheltered bay. The sandy beach, dog-friendly all year, is perfect for family fun. Swim, explore the rock pools, build sandcastles and play ball games. At high tide the jetty is an excellent spot for crabbing; look out for seals, dolphins and whales in the waters beyond. Runswick Bay is an excellent holiday base for walkers, with the Cleveland Way running along the beach. Make light work of your self-catering stay with visits to the village cafe, tea shop and hotel bars. For holiday souvenirs, search for Jurassic fossils – they’re common along this part of the Yorkshire Coast.
Runswick Bay is a great base for exploring the North Yorkshire coast and countryside. Walk the Cleveland Way north to Staithes, a village full of historical quirks, or head south to foodie-favourite Sandsend. Venture further and a bustling harbour, cliff-top abbey ruins and countless fish and chip restaurants are synonymous with Whitby. Take a tour of the town’s gothic yards, cobbled streets and traditional seaside amusements for a full taste of local life. Catch a North Yorkshire Moors Railway train from Whitby for a car-free day out in the national park. Alternatively, drive to the Danby Lodge visitor centre, where family-friendly activities include a fabulous children’s adventure playground and climbing cave.
